Rhosalia Signature Font Review

As a small business owner, I’ve learned that even the smallest details can make a big difference in how customers perceive your brand. Recently, I was tasked with updating the packaging for a local bakery’s custom cupcakes. The old labels felt a bit generic, and I wanted something that would stand out while still feeling elegant and approachable. That’s when I discovered Rhosalia Signature—a monoline script font that exudes grace and charm.

Rhosalia Signature is a premium font that belongs to the Script Amp category. It’s designed with smooth, flowing lines that give it a sense of movement and sophistication. Unlike some more ornate script fonts, Rhosalia maintains a clean and readable structure, making it ideal for both digital and print applications. Its style feels personal yet polished, perfect for businesses looking to add a touch of refinement without sacrificing clarity.

When to Use Rhosalia Signature

Rhosalia Signature shines best in display text and short phrases. It’s not the best choice for long paragraphs, but for headlines, titles, and decorative accents, it’s a standout. For example, using it on a skincare label gives the product a luxurious feel, while on a candle jar, it adds a subtle touch of class.

It also pairs well with other fonts. I often use it alongside a clean sans serif like Montserrat or a classic serif like Georgia. This creates a balanced visual hierarchy that guides the eye without being distracting. The contrast between the script and the solid typefaces helps maintain readability while adding visual interest.

Readability and Practical Considerations

While Rhosalia Signature is beautiful, it’s important to consider where and how it will be used. On small labels or mobile screens, the font can become harder to read if not sized appropriately. I recommend using it at larger sizes for headings and keeping it simple for body text. When printing on packaging, ensure that the font is high resolution and properly embedded to avoid any issues during production.

Another thing to keep in mind is the font’s file formats and licensing. Rhosalia Signature likely comes in multiple styles, such as regular, bold, or alternate versions. Make sure to check which files are included and whether they’re suitable for your intended use—whether it’s for print, web, or commercial products.
